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8229 3053 5585 5195159
15262357166 18016504683 073
15262357166 18016504683 073
76 37535 6355350
All about undefined
Interested in learning more?
15262357166 18016504683 073
76 37535 6355350
See more
37038 3400999 1806461807
8700124847 95885978937 568 5567 21
See more
32928 262
3909 9531 9080261 174
See more